France (Paris mint), 12 sols, Louis XI, 1789/6-A, encapsulated NGC MS 62, tied for finest known in NGC census, unlisted overdate. Bold strike with nice toning and luster around details (tied with one other MS 62 at NGC), light adjustment marks on both sides, clear overdate that is not mentioned inside the slab but is very interesting and important because 1787 and 1788 are "reported, not confirmed" (according to KM) and 1789/6 would seem to condemn the existence of the dates in between.
